Discover the tranquil beauty of Mirador de la Piedra in Jaibalito, Guatemala, where lush pine forests meet the expansive, peaceful waters of Lake Atitlán under a soft, cloud-diffused sky. This reflective moment reveals nature’s calming embrace, inviting you to escape into a slow, contemplative hike surrounded by delicate mountain mists and gentle breezes. The scene captures an intimate connection with raw, untouched landscapes — an ideal retreat for those seeking quiet adventure and soulful immersion in Guatemala’s highland wilderness.

The nearest airport is La Aurora International Airport (GUA), approximately a 3.5-hour drive from Jaibalito.
